Settings
Open settings from the gear icon in the bottom-left of the sidebar, or with the keyboard shortcut shown there on hover.
Settings is organized into four tabs.
General
The General tab covers the app’s appearance and hotkey configuration.
| Setting | What it does |
|---|---|
| Theme | Pick from five themes — see Themes. |
| Density | Adjusts spacing for the chat pane (Comfortable / Compact). |
| Show status bar | Toggle the bottom status strip on/off. |
| Overlay hotkey | Global shortcut to open the quick-query overlay. |
| Screenshot hotkey | Global shortcut to invoke macOS region capture. See Screenshot capture. |
| Help → Show tour again | Re-runs the first-launch onboarding tour. |
To set a hotkey, click the current shortcut value and press the new combination. Press Esc to cancel a recording without changing it.
Prompts
Settings for the Prompts library.
| Setting | What it does |
|---|---|
| Prompts folder | Where your .md prompt files live. Defaults to ~/Documents/Ekorbia/Prompts/. |
| Browse | Open the folder picker to choose a different location. |
| Reveal in Finder | Open the current prompts folder in Finder. |
| Reset to default | Point the prompts folder back to ~/Documents/Ekorbia/Prompts/. The current folder is not deleted. |
| Restore built-in prompts | Re-copy the 28 shipped prompts into the prompts folder (overwrites existing files with the same name). |
Memory
Settings for the Memory file.
| Setting | What it does |
|---|---|
| Memory file path | Path to the Markdown file injected at the start of every chat. Defaults to ~/Documents/Ekorbia/memory.md. |
| Choose file… | Open the file picker to point at a different file. |
| Reset to default | Point the path back to the default. The current file is not deleted. |
| Edit memory | Open the current memory file in your OS default text editor. |
Attachments
Settings that apply to files, folders, and embeddings.
| Setting | What it does |
|---|---|
| Embedding model | Which Ollama model produces the embeddings used for chunk retrieval. Defaults to nomic-embed-text. Changing this triggers the Stale-Embeddings banner. |
| Top-k chunks | How many top-ranked chunks Ekorbia retrieves on each send. Defaults to 6. Higher = more context, slower, more tokens. |
| Folder file types | Comma-separated list of file extensions the folder walker includes. Defaults to .md, .txt, .pdf. |
| Folder ignore patterns | Comma-separated list of directory names the folder walker skips. Defaults to .git, node_modules, target, dist, build, .venv, .next, .cache. |
Re-indexing after an embedding-model change
If you change the embedding model, existing chunks become unusable (different models produce non-comparable vectors). A yellow Stale-Embeddings banner appears above the chat with a one-click Re-index all button. Use it to re-embed every attachment with the new model.
You can also re-index a single folder anytime via the ↻ refresh icon on its chip.
Persisted UI state
These are saved automatically (not in the Settings panel — they update as you use the app):
- Sidebar width
- Right-panel width
- Prompt-list column width
- Panel open/closed state
- Right-panel selected tab (Prompts / Watches / Files)
- Selected model (per-window for main, separately for the overlay)
- Active theme
- Folder filters (in case you’ve customized them)
All of this survives across launches.
